Leaking basement repair services focus on identifying and fixing sources of water intrusion in basement areas. This process typically involves inspecting the foundation, walls, and floors to determine where water is entering. Contractors may use specialized tools such as moisture meters, cameras, and flood testing to locate leaks or seepage points. Once the problem areas are identified, repairs can include sealing cracks, applying waterproof coatings, installing drainage systems, or improving grading around the property to prevent water from pooling near the foundation. These services aim to create a dry, stable basement environment by addressing the root causes of leaks.
This type of repair helps solve common issues like persistent dampness, mold growth, and structural damage caused by water infiltration. Water leaks can lead to weakened foundation walls, rotting wood, and increased humidity that fosters mold and mildew. Addressing leaks early can prevent more extensive and costly repairs down the line. Leaking basement repair services are suitable for various types of properties, including single-family homes, townhouses, and multi-unit buildings with basements or crawl spaces. These services are often requested after noticing signs of water intrusion, such as damp walls, water stains, or musty odors. Homes in areas with high groundwater levels or heavy rainfall can be particularly vulnerable and may require regular maintenance or preventative waterproofing measures. Commercial properties with below-ground levels can also benefit from these services to maintain structural integrity and prevent water-related damage.
Homeowners should consider leaking basement repair services when experiencing ongoing moisture problems or visible signs of water entry. If basement walls or floors are damp, cracked, or show signs of efflorescence (white mineral deposits), it may indicate a leak that needs professional attention. Addressing these issues promptly can help protect the property’s foundation, improve indoor air quality, and preserve the value of the home. What are common signs of a leaking basement? Signs include water stains, mold growth, musty odors, and damp or efflorescence on basement walls and floors.
How do professionals typically repair a leaking basement? They may use methods such as sealing cracks, applying waterproof coatings, installing drainage systems, or exterior waterproofing techniques.
Can basement leaks cause structural damage? Yes, persistent leaks can weaken foundation walls and compromise the structural integrity of a building over time.
What should be considered before choosing a basement leak repair service? It's important to evaluate the contractor’s experience, methods used, and reviews from other homeowners in the area.
Are there preventative measures to avoid basement leaks? Proper grading, maintaining gutters and downspouts, and ensuring proper drainage around the foundation can help reduce the risk of leaks.
